What does mandrels mean?

noun

A mandrel is a cylindrical or conical rod or bar, typically of metal, used as a guide or support for shaping or forming other objects. Mandrels are often used in metalworking, woodworking, and other crafts.

Example

"The metalworker used a mandrel to shape the curved pipe into the desired form."
